Role description:

Role accountabilities:

  • Engineering design for numerous roadway drainage and design-build projects including collector streets, urban arterials, rural and urban expressways, interstates, and bridge replacements across the southeast.
  • Assist in all aspects of roadway drainage design including bridge hydraulic studies, culvert design, closed drainage system design, post construction water quality structures design, and erosion and sedimentation control.
  • Prepare construction plans and project displays.
  • Prepare cost estimates, reports and technical memos.
  • Utilize various design software including MicroStation, Inroads, GeoPak, Open Roads, AutoCAD Civil 3d, Microsoft Excel, GIS, HEC-RAS, HY8, FlowMaster, ICPR, StormCAD, SMS, SRH2D, and HEC-RAS 2D to assist with the design and preparation of construction plans.
  • Coordinate with project managers, ecologists, and roadway engineers.
  • Direct junior engineer’s design activities.

Qualifications & Experience:

Required Qualifications

  • 7+ years of drainage design and project management experience.
  • Bachelor’s degree in Engineering
  • EIT

Key Attributes

  • Experience working on DOT projects a plus.
  • Basic understanding of FEMA floodplain regulations
  • Knowledge of stormwater design including open channel conveyance and closed drainage systems.
  • Knowledge of stormwater treatment using appropriate BMPs suitable for the linear nature of transportation projects.
  • Use of various software platforms including Bentley’s StormCAD, CulvertMaster, FlowMaster, ICPR, HEC-RAS, HEC-HMS, HY8, ICPR, SWMM, SMS, SRH2D, and HEC-RAS 2D.
  • Possess good communication (written and verbal), teamwork skills and the flexibility to complete a wide range of tasks including field work.
  • Exhibit the initiative and ability to tackle new projects and other challenges regularly.
  • NCEES record a plus.
